S.J. Kumaresh v. The Commissioner Of Police
BEFORE THE MADURAI BENCH OF MADRAS HIGH COURT DATED: 09.10.2018
CORAM
THE H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E N.ANAND VENKATESH CRL.O.P.(MD)No.17975 of 2018 S.J.Kumaresh ... Petitioner Vs 1.The Commissioner of Police Madurai City, Madurai.
2. The Assistant Commissioner of Police Madurai Central Vilakkuthoon Police Station Madurai- 625 001 3.The Inspector of Police Theppakulam Police Station Madurai City, Madurai.
4. M.R.N.Ashlatha ... Respondents PRAYER: Criminal Original Petition filed under Section 482 of Cr.P.C, praying, to direct the second and third respondents not to harass the petitioner his family members and the purchasers by compelling them to settle the civil dispute regarding the petitioner's family property in favour of the fourth respondent, thereby interfering in civil matterts.
For Petitioner : Mr.S.R.Anbarasu For Respondents : Mr.K.Suyambulinga Bharathi No.1 to 3 Government Advocate(Crl.Side)
ORDER
This criminal original petition has been filed for a direction to the second respondent herein not to harass the petitioner his family members.
2.The learned Government Advocate(Crl.Side) for the first respondent submits that there is no petition pending against the petitioner.
3.Recording the said submission, this criminal original petition is closed.
